Abstract

The utility model discloses a hinge and an opening and closing device, a hinge comprising: a first hinge seat, the first hinge seat comprising a first hinge part and a first mounting part, the first mounting part being used to connect with the door body of the opening and closing device; a second hinge seat, the second hinge seat comprising a second hinge part and a second mounting part, the second hinge part being rotatably connected to the first hinge part, the second mounting part being used to connect with the box body of the opening and closing device, a limiting hole being further provided on the second hinge part, a reinforcing rib plate being provided in the limiting hole, the limiting hole being butted with a limiting protrusion on the box body of the opening and closing device, the reinforcing rib plate being butted with a slot on the limiting protrusion. The hinge of the utility model can prevent backward tilting when opening the door, and the structure is firm and reliable.

Description

Hinge and opening and closing equipment
Technical Field
The utility model relates to the field of hinges, in particular to a hinge.
Background
The door hinge is a device which is arranged on the door body and realizes the opening and closing of the door body. For example, door hinges for use in ice chests, which include a fixed base coupled to the chest, a swivel base coupled to the chest, and a spindle extending through the fixed base and swivel base, some door hinges also include an elastic member.
Wherein, due to the thrust of the door opening, the elasticity and inertia of the elastic piece, etc., a very large moment can be formed, the rotary seat is enabled to be subjected to large force when rotating, the rotary seat and the fixing seat are fixed into a whole through the mandrel, and the force can drive the fixing seat to lean backwards. If the fixing seat is connected with the cabinet body only by the screw, the backward tilting of the hinge cannot be completely avoided, so that the door hinge structure is not firm enough, and the door hinge is easy to loosen after long-term use.
Disclosure of utility model
The utility model provides a hinge capable of preventing backward tilting and having a firm and reliable structure when a door is opened and opening and closing equipment, which is realized by the following technical scheme:
A hinge, comprising:
the first hinge seat comprises a first hinge part and a first installation part, and the first installation part is used for being connected with a door body of the opening and closing equipment;

Further, the opening direction of the limiting hole is perpendicular to the extending direction of the second installation part.

Detailed Description
The present utility model will be described in further detail with reference to the drawings and detailed description.
As shown in fig. 1 to 4, the present embodiment provides a hinge including:
a first hinge base 1, wherein the first hinge base 1 comprises a first hinge part 11 and a first mounting part 12, and the first mounting part 12 is used for being connected with a door body 4 of the opening and closing equipment;

In this embodiment, the first hinge seat 1 is a rotating seat, and the second hinge seat 2 is a fixed seat. The hinge may be connected between the door 4 and the housing 3 of an opening and closing device (e.g. an ice chest) such that the door 4 and the housing 3 are hinged. Wherein, be provided with first mounting hole on the first installation department 12, be provided with the second mounting hole on the second installation department 22, first articulated seat 1 accessible first mounting hole mounting screw to be connected with door body 4, second articulated seat 2 accessible second mounting hole mounting screw to be connected with box 3.
In this embodiment, the first hinge base 1 is connected to the side wall of the door body 4 through the first mounting portion 12, and rotates along with the door body 4, the second hinge base 2 is connected to the side wall of the case 3 through the second mounting portion 22, and when the door body 4 is closed with the case 3, the first hinge portion 11 and the second hinge portion 21 can be regarded as the same plane.
As shown in fig. 5 to 6, the hinge has a first posture and a second posture, and the first hinge seat 1 can reciprocally rotate within a preset angle range relative to the second hinge seat 2, so that the first mating structure and the second mating structure relatively slide, and the hinge is switched between the first posture and the second posture. When the hinge is assembled, the first gesture of the hinge can be corresponding to the closed state of the door body 4 of the opening and closing device and the state with smaller opening angle of the door body 4, and the second gesture can be corresponding to the maximum opening state of the door body 4 of the opening and closing device and the state with larger opening angle of the door body 4.

Further, referring to fig. 1, the opening direction of the limiting hole 211 is perpendicular to the extending direction of the second mounting portion 22. Further, the second hinge portion 21 has a second connection surface 214 parallel to the extending direction of the second mounting portion 22, and the limiting hole 211 is formed on the second connection surface 214. Further, the second hinge portion 21 has a first connecting surface 213 perpendicularly connected to the second mounting portion 22, and a second connecting surface 214 perpendicularly connected to the first connecting surface 213, and the limiting hole 211 is formed in the second connecting surface 214.
In this embodiment, when the second mounting portion 22 is mounted in the vertical direction, the opening direction of the limiting hole 211 is the horizontal direction. That is, the second hinge portion 21 is assembled with the case 3 in a flat insertion manner.
The scheme of the embodiment has the following advantages: (1) Compared with the lower inserting type hinge, the hinge is troublesome to install, the door body 4 of the opening and closing device needs to be lifted up and then the hinge can be inserted, and the hinge is in a flat inserting type, and the door body 4 does not need to be lifted up and can be directly inserted during installation; (2) Compared with the risk that the downward-inserted hinge is inclined backward and separated when the strength test is carried out, the hinge has better strength, can limit in the backward and upward directions, and has no risk of inclined backward and separated; (3) Compared with the lower plug-in hinge structure, the hinge has the advantages that the design difficulty of the box body 3 is higher, and the hinge is simple in flat plug-in structure.
Further, referring to fig. 1, at least two reinforcing ribs 212 are provided, and at least two reinforcing ribs 212 are spaced apart along the axial direction of the second mounting portion 22. In this way, the structural strength of the second hinge part 21 can be further enhanced.
Further, referring to fig. 1, a plurality of limiting holes 211 are provided, and the plurality of limiting holes 211 are sequentially arranged along the axial direction of the second mounting portion 22. Therefore, the connection strength between the second hinge seat 2 and the box body 3 can be further enhanced, and the backward tilting prevention effect is enhanced.
